// Broker upgrade notes for plugin authors:
// Quillbus 4.x replaces the legacy 3.x wire protocol. Plugins must
// construct the client with explicit protocol negotiation enabled,
// or connections to the Larkfield cluster will be silently downgraded
// and dropped after 30s. Topic names are unchanged. For local testing
// against the sandbox broker, authenticate with the key below.

API key for bafof-bagaf: qvz2-qi

## Bounce Processor Notes

The Mailcroft bounce processor consumes provider webhooks and emits normalized bounce events your plugin can subscribe to. Hard bounces suppress the address immediately; soft bounces retry three times over 48 hours. Plugins must be idempotent — duplicate events happen during failover. Never mark addresses deliverable from plugin code; only the core suppression list does that. Event schemas, retry semantics, and the sandbox setup are documented on this page.

runbook for badug-kadup: https://confluence.zemvarlabs.internal/projects/browse/display/projects/bd1b

## Step 4: Enable the EXIF Scrubber

Alright, this is the step where PixelRinse actually starts stripping metadata from uploads. Everything before this was plumbing; now we point the ingest workers at the scrubber sidecar. Heads up: the old Duskmere pipeline left GPS tags intact on thumbnails, so expect a backfill job later — don't worry about that yet. Deploy the sidecar, confirm the health check goes green, then apply the config. The scrubber expects the following values in its environment.

settings of yageg-yahap:
[gorael]
team = olieth
access_code = ac_941d74
owner = brieth.aldiel
host = gorael.tolvaqio.internal
port = 6379
peer = briwyn.urlaqtech.internal
salt = 116e6622
pin = 1957

## Formula sandbox tuning

User-supplied formulas in Gridmoor execute inside a restricted interpreter with hard ceilings on time, memory, and call depth. Reviewers should confirm any change to these ceilings is justified in the PR description, since raising them widens the abuse surface. Defaults were chosen from production traces. The current limits are as follows.

limits module of tafog-fawip:
WEIGHTS = {
    "julix": 57,
    "lamys": 992,
    "kasvan": 209,
    "quenok": 750,
    "alddor": 259,
    "oliath": 1009,
    "wenix": 815,
}